Smoke from ceiling fan sparks evacuation at motel, Cleveland TN
Smoke was reported coming from a ceiling fan in room 28 at a motel near Georgetown Road Northwest. It is suspected to be caused by an electrical short. Occupants of the motel were evacuating the building as smoke was present but no active fire confirmed. Fire and rescue units responded to the scene.
